Core Processes in Vulnerability Assessment Services
The process of vulnerability assessment involves multiple stages: identification, classification, evaluation, and mitigation strategies. Automated platforms scan applications for common flaws, often cross-referencing with catalogs such as CVE. expert evaluations complement these tools by detecting context-specific flaws that software might overlook. The assessment document provides not only a list of vulnerabilities but also action plans for remediation.
Different Approaches to Security Assessment
Cybersecurity evaluations are broadly grouped into several forms, each serving a specific purpose:
1. Network-Based Vulnerability Assessments focus on intranets and gateways.
2. Device-level assessments examine endpoints for misconfigurations.
3. Web application security tests analyze websites for authentication problems.
4. Database vulnerability checks identify weak permissions.
5. Wireless Assessments test for rogue devices.
Ethical Hacking Services Explained
Penetration testing take the idea of gap analysis a step further by simulating attacks on system flaws. Ethical hackers use the equivalent tactics as black-hat hackers, but in an authorized environment. This mock intrusion helps enterprises see the practical risks of vulnerabilities in a practical manner, leading to more effective remediation.

How Assessments and Hacking Work Together
When structured assessments are combined with penetration tests, the result is a comprehensive defensive posture. The assessments identify flaws, while ethical hacking confirms their real-world risk. This dual-layer approach ensures security teams do not simply document vulnerabilities but also realize how they can be exploited in practice.
